| | History and Geography of Fisheries and Aquaculture | | | Since ancient times, the seas and oceans have been "hunting areas" in which Man has caught fish and marine mammals and collected edible molluscs and seaweed on the shores. Gradually, boats, hunting and fishing implements improved, increasing the scope of food-gathering. Aquaculture developed progressively, complementing wild fish catches as a source of food and livelihoods. The history and geography of such developments, at global, regional or national level provide very valuable information on the sector, its development and management.
